Toro Rosso F1 gearbox Peter Windsor recently reported that Scuderia Toro Rosso (STR) use a different gearbox case to the RedBull Racing (RBR) car. Reportedly he said it was slimmer to allow more air over the diffuser. I know they use the same seamless gearbox cluster and that RBR use a cast aluminium case. But from what I’ve ever seen of the STR03 and RB4 they are identical aside from the engine and some of the newer aero details not appearing on the STR03. I didn’t believe that STR had any design capacity at their Faenza factory since the Red bull buy out? It doesn’t make sense that Red Bull Technologies (the company that design the pairs cars) has designed a case specifically for the STR03, the Engine Regs demands a fixed crank shaft centre height, so it can’t for packaging reasons on the Ferrari engine.
